#DBE971 Hex color

#DBE971

The hexadecimal color code #DBE971 corresponds to the code RGB( 219, 233, 113 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,86 level), green (at 0,91 level) and blue (at 0,44 level). Its brightness is 67% and its saturation is 73%. It is composed of red at 38%, green at 41% and blue at 20%.

Uses of #DBE971 in CSS

When using #DBE971 as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#DBE971 as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
